Transaction 90bba75e8056c9304a9efc6858da73b0f130bb37c42f45270ba1dc743a0fce08

1 Input
2 Outputs
  • 90bba75e8056c9304a9efc6858da73b0f130bb37c42f45270ba1dc743a0fce08:0
  • value  96323571
    address  3Fw9NUe5S7fkSsYRMSAE79YSrQgnk7v71M
  • 90bba75e8056c9304a9efc6858da73b0f130bb37c42f45270ba1dc743a0fce08:1
  • value  27668900
    address  1KrX4kKkYErFXA8Ex6xG3oF2xj8f2Mont1